Mashua and Cleome serrulata growing conditions include, comparison of Mashua and Cleome serrulata season and the amount of sunlight required for their growth. They are as follows:
Mashua Season: Fall, Spring and Summer
Mashua Sunlight: Full Sun, Partial shade, Partial Sun
Cleome serrulata Season: Summer
Cleome serrulata Sunlight: Full Sun, Partial shade, Partial Sun

Mashua bloom time is Early Fall, Early Summer, Fall, Indeterminate, Late Spring, Late Summer and Summer whereas Cleome serrulata bloom time is Summer and Late Summer.
